Monthly payment breakdown — St. Louis

Median home price $185,000, 25% down ($46,250), 6.5% rate, 30-year fixed.

ComponentMonthlyAnnual
Principal & interest$877/mo$10,524/yr
Property tax (1.35% rate)$208/mo$2,496/yr
Homeowner insurance (est.)$77/mo$924/yr
Total PITI$1,162/mo$13,944/yr

Frequently asked questions

Can I afford a home in St. Louis?

Median home price in St. Louis is $185,000. At 6.5% with 25% down ($46,250), the monthly PITI is $1,162. To keep housing costs at or below 28% of gross income, you need $49,809/year. The median household income in St. Louis is $52,000, which means the typical household can qualify.

What income do you need to buy a house in St. Louis?

To afford the median St. Louis home at $185,000 with 25% down and a 6.5% rate, you need approximately $49,809/year. This applies the 28% front-end DTI limit used by conventional lenders. Increasing your down payment or waiting for lower rates reduces this threshold.

What is the property tax rate in St. Louis?

The effective property tax rate in St. Louis, Missouri is 1.35% annually. On the median home of $185,000, that is $208/month or $2,496/year in property taxes. Property taxes are included in PITI and count toward the 28% front-end DTI limit.

How much is a down payment on a house in St. Louis?

On the St. Louis median home price of $185,000, a 20% down payment is $37,000 and a 25% down payment is $46,250. Putting down at least 20% eliminates PMI. For homes above $766,550, you will need a jumbo loan, which typically requires 20-30% down and stricter income documentation.
